texte = Thomas:You should use card=IGNORECARD. Have you tried accepting a card type of card=DINERS? If that doesn't work please contact me directly - Diners Club cards should work with our [validcard] tag. Thanks.John. >We have a shopping cart system that works fine, except we have just >discovered that it can't handle Diners Club cards. It returns Error: we >do not accept that type of credit card. The purchase command does NOT >specify the card parameter, so I am assuming it defaults to accepting >all cards. It works fine for Visa, Mastercard, Amex and Bankcard (an >Australian credit card) but not for Diners. The Diners number is shorter, >14 digits instead of 16. > >FYI, the diners number starts with 3647. > >I have tested this with [validcard] and the card numbers fail, even when >I use &card=IGNORE, despite what the documentation says. > >Any ideas? > >Thanks >Thomas > >Thomas Wedderburn-Bisshop >Technical Director >Woomera Net Solutions >Sydney, Australia Phone +61 2 9746 0700 fax +61 2 9751 6941 John A.
